| Migration |
What is migration? Connections
p. 92
Qu. 1 - 5 Summary
|
Use pupils own experiences about movement.
Investigate the reasons. List reasons why pupils may move
in the future.
Sort reasons into push and pull factors.
Mexico
city as a case study. |
